General Terms and Conditions for Participation in Competitions

These terms and conditions define the relationship between artists and the organizers of the ABSURIA International Festival of Abstract and Surrealist Photography in Tours (non-profits organization).

1- Prizes

The organizers will select, from among those registered for the competition, the photographers whose work will be exhibited: the nominees.

The nominated photographers will be exhibited:

  • in physical exhibition venues in the city of Tours
  • in dedicated digital galleries on the Festival website: www.absuria.fr

The jury will select the winners of the Awards from among the nominees.

Award categories

Professional Category
Abstraction: 1st, 2nd, and 3rd Prizes
Surrealism: 1st, 2nd, and 3rd Prizes

Amateur Category
Abstraction: 1st, 2nd, and 3rd Prizes
Surrealism: 1st, 2nd, and 3rd Prizes

Special prizes may be awarded by competition partners. The prizes will be published on the ABSURIA International Festival of Abstract and Surrealist Photography website.

Prize winners will be featured in exhibitions.

An exclusive work of art created specifically for the ABSURIA competition will be presented to each winner.

2 – Benefits for winning and nominated artists – Image usage rights for prizes.

Nominated artists will be exhibited as part of ABSURIA and will benefit from inclusion in the ABSURIA Festival’s promotional tools.

Nominated artists receive a certificate of participation and selection for the ABSURIA Festival.

They are published in the digital galleries on the ABSURIA Festival website. They remain on display in the ABSURIA Festival web galleries for the year of their nomination, along with the winners and the titles of the awards they received.

Artists may include their nomination in their own communications, with the option of including the image of the award. These rights are granted only to nominees. Winners may use references to their award and the image of the award.

The representation of the ABSURIA Awards is the property of the ABSURIA association, which manages the International Festival of Abstract and Surrealist Photography in Tours.

4 – Copyright

ABSURIA respects your rights and does not claim any copyright on the images you submit to the contest; you will retain full copyright for each work.

4.1 Artists who have created a personal online space remain the owners of all copyrights relating to the works of art and information contained in their application file.

4.2 Finalists and winners grant ABSURIA a free reproduction right, limited to 99 years, for their works and across all territories.

The right of reproduction is limited to communication by ABSURIA and its partners (press releases, publications on the website, publications on social networks, all types and media of ABSURIA communication, etc.) worldwide. Each publication must be accompanied by the artist’s name and, if technically possible, the URL of their website or Instagram or Facebook page.

No work may be marketed directly by ABSURIA without the express authorization of the artist. Only the exhibition catalog/book may be marketed by ABSURIA, respecting all information related to the authors of the published photographs.

5 – Entry form – registration

Participants in the competition must be aged 18 or over on the date of registration. It is open to professionals and amateurs with no age or geographical restrictions.

Each artist must complete an entry form and pay the registration fee based on the number of works entered.

Each registration is limited to 6 works. There is no limit to the number of registrations.

The information contained in the registration forms must be accurate, otherwise the entry will be disqualified.

Any type of camera may be used to capture an image for the competition, including a cell phone. Photographs taken without a camera on photosensitive paper may also be submitted.

7 – Description of technical data

Image file requirements

To enter the contest, you must submit low-resolution image files using the form on the Website.

The format must be JPEG and must not exceed 6 Mo. No watermarks, borders, or signatures may be included. Images must not be compressed or placed in a folder.

No digital files will be returned.

Please ensure that you have a copy of the files entered in the contest. ABSURIA will take all reasonable measures to ensure the secure storage and backup of the files entered, but cannot be held responsible for exceptional circumstances, including cases of force majeure.

The organizers cannot be held responsible for images submitted incorrectly.

Nominated photographers will have 10 days to provide the organizers with a high-resolution version of the shortlisted image, if necessary. The file must match the color and cropping of the low-resolution JPEG file originally submitted during registration.

Failure to provide a high-resolution file within 10 days of the request may result in disqualification. If you are unable to provide the information by the deadline but contact ABSURIA to inform the organizers within the 10-day period, ABSURIA reserves the right to grant the participant additional time based on the specific circumstances. Any extension is at the sole discretion of ABSURIA.

8 – Printing of exhibited works

The works exhibited will be printed at the organizers’ expense, unless otherwise specified by the photographer, who will send them in a timely manner and in accordance with the organizers’ technical requirements. These details will be specified by the organizers to the nominees. The prints produced by the organizer will be made according to the organization’s decisions: type of medium and format. Minimum size 24×30 cm. The final printing technique will be determined by the organization depending on the exhibition venue.

14 – Cancellation

The Organizer shall not be held liable for any cancellation or postponement resulting from a case of force majeure as defined by Article 1218 of the French Civil Code and considered as such by French case law and courts: “Force majeure in contractual matters occurs when an event beyond the control of the debtor, which could not reasonably have been foreseen at the time of conclusion of the contract and whose effects cannot be avoided by appropriate measures, prevents the debtor from performing its obligation.”
